WORK PROGRAMME OF THE NATIONAL ASSEMBLY
1. Motion based on art. 43, paragraph 7 of the Rules of Organization and Procedure of the National Assembly of the Blue Coalition parliamentary group– UtDf, DSB, United Agrarians, BSDP, RDP – draft resolution on amendments to art. 15 of the ROPNA Annex “ Financial rules of the National Assembly’s budget” (submitted: Vanyo Sharkov and a group of MPs on 25/07/2011)
2. Motion based on art. 43, paragraph 7 of the Rules of Organization and Procedure of the National Assembly of the parliamentary group of Ataka party: draft resolution on recognition of the genocide of Armenians at the Ottoman Empire in 1915-1922 (submitted: Volen Siderov and a group of MPs on 14/07/2009)
3. Termination of powers of a Member of the Parliament
4. Draft resolutions on amendments to the membership of the permanent delegations of the National Assembly (submitted: Dimitar Glavchev on 29/12/2011; Remzi Osman on 10/01/2012; Krasimir Velchev on 10/01/2012)
5. Draft resolution condemning the forced assimilation of Bulgarian Muslims (submitted: Ivan Kostov and a group of MPs on 28/10/2011)
6. Draft resolution on the transformation of the department of “Public Health” of the University in the town of Ruse “Angel Kanchev" into a “School(Faculty) of Public Health and Healthcare”(submitted: Council of Ministers on 18/11/2011)
7. Account report of the Council for Electronic Media for the period 01/01/2011 – 30/06/2011(submitted: Council for Electronic Media)
8. First reading of the Bill amending and supplementing the Ministry of Interior Act (submitted Yordan Bakalov on 09/11/2011)
9. First reading of the Bill supplementing the Atmospheric Air Purity Act (submitted: Dzhevdet Chakurov. Plamen Oresharski and Rumen Takorov on 06.12.2011)
10. Annual reports of the Communications Regulation Commission (submitted Communications Regulation Commission on 01/07/2011)
11. 2010 annual report on the activities of the National Health Insurance Fund (submitted: Council of Ministers on 30/06.2011)
12. Parliamentary control – Friday, 13/01/2012 at 9 am)
